What types of immigration cases do attorneys in the Wittenberg, WI area typically handle?

Immigration attorneys serving Wittenberg and Shawano County commonly handle family-based petitions (I-130), adjustment of status (I-485), naturalization (N-400), and work visas. Given the local agricultural and manufacturing economy, they also frequently assist with H-2A seasonal agricultural worker visas and employment-based petitions for nearby industries. They can help with DACA renewals, removal defense, and consular processing cases that originate from this region.

Are there any unique immigration challenges for agricultural workers in the Wittenberg area?

Yes, agricultural workers in Shawano and Marathon counties often face challenges with H-2A visa compliance, seasonal employment gaps affecting status, and access to legal resources in rural areas. An experienced local attorney understands the specific requirements of regional farms and processing plants and can navigate issues related to housing, transportation, and wage regulations under Wisconsin law. They can also advise on pathways to longer-term status for essential workers in this critical local industry.

What should I expect during my first consultation with an immigration attorney in Wittenberg?

During a typical initial consultation at a Wittenberg-area law firm, you'll discuss your immigration history, goals, and any deadlines (like DACA expirations or court dates). The attorney will review your documents, explain relevant Wisconsin and federal procedures, and outline potential strategies and fees. This meeting is confidential and helps determine if your case might benefit from local resources, such as connections to interpreters or community support services in Central Wisconsin.

Can a Wittenberg-based attorney help me if I have an immigration court case in Milwaukee or Chicago?

Absolutely. Immigration attorneys licensed in Wisconsin can represent you in Immigration Courts throughout the state, including the Milwaukee Immigration Court, as well as before USCIS offices in Milwaukee or Appleton. Many also practice before the Chicago Immigration Court, which has jurisdiction over some Wisconsin cases. They will manage travel and communication logistics, and their understanding of the local context in Wittenberg can be valuable in presenting your case to the court.
